Erik van der Luijt

Born:

Pianist Erik van der Luijt's new album "Express Yourself" has just been released to wonderful reviews in The Netherlands. This is his first private production for his piano trio, further consisting of Branko Teuwen on double bass and Victor de Boo on drums. Erik, residing in Amsterdam, The Netherlands, has been leading his trio for several years now, but only recently started writing his own material. To date Erik has contributed to numerous projects, among which are recordings with the Metropole Orchestra, performances with The Orchestra of the Concertgebouw, Rita Reys, Greetje Kauffeld, Madeline Bell, Piet Noordijk and many others

Album

Express Yourself

Label: Unknown label
Released: 2005
Track listing: Corleone, Keep On Walking, Havana Blue, Minor Changes, Mucho Macho, Nostalgia, Me And My Guitar, Theo & Ellen, Land Of The Triplets, Skyscape, No Guts No Glory.
